表单验证,确定必须字段不留空
<!--
/*
确认输入字段不是空白,否则显示错误消息
$(document).ready(function(){
$('.error').hide();
$('.submit').click(function(event){
var data = $('.infobox').val(); <!-- -->
var len = data.length;
if(len < 1){
$('.error').show("slow");
event.preventDefault(); <!--preventDefault()防止按钮把用户数据提交到服务器 -->
}else{
$('.error').hide();
}
});
});*/
/*
只允许输入数字
*/
$(document).ready(function(){
$('.error').hide();
$('.submit').click(function(event){
var data = $('.infobox').val();
var len = data.length;
var c;
if(len > 0){
for(var i=0; i
if(c==45 || i==0){ <!-- 允许为负数 -->
continue;
}
if(c < 48 || c > 57){
$('.error').show("slow").html("必须为数值!");
event.preventDefault();
}else{
$('.error').hide();
}
}
}
if(len == 0){ <!-- 同时不能为空 -->
$('.error').show("slow").text("不能为空!");
event.preventDefault();
}
if(len > 0 && len == 1){
c = data.charAt(0).charCodeAt();
if(c < 48 || c > 57){
$('.error').show("slow").html("必须为数值!");
event.preventDefault();
}else{
$('.error').hide();
}
}
});
});
// -->
User IDThis field cannot be blank
分享到:
相关推荐
- `required`: 验证字段是否为空,不能为空。 - `remote`: 使用AJAX调用指定的URL检查输入值的有效性。 - `email`: 验证输入是否为有效的电子邮件地址。 - `url`: 检查输入是否为有效的网址。 - `date`: 验证...
4. **数字验证**:检查输入是否为数字,可以指定是否接受负数、小数等。 5. **URL验证**:确认输入的是否为有效的URL地址。 6. **日期验证**:验证日期格式是否正确。 7. **自定义正则表达式验证**:允许开发者根据...
### jQuery Validate 表单验证插件使用方法 在前端开发中,表单验证是一项非常重要的功能,它确保用户提交的数据符合预期的要求。jQuery Validate插件是基于jQuery的一个强大的表单验证库,它提供了多种预定义的...
《jQuery validate.js 表单验证详解》 在Web开发中,表单验证是不可或缺的一环,它确保用户输入的数据符合预设的要求,提高用户体验并减少服务器端的压力。jQuery validate.js插件是实现这一功能的强大工具,它提供...
总的来说,`jQuery.validate.js` 提供了一个强大且灵活的框架,可以帮助开发者创建高效且用户体验良好的表单验证机制,从而确保收集到的数据准确无误。结合其丰富的自定义选项和预定义规则,可以适应各种复杂的验证...
jQuery Validate插件是jQuery的一个强大的表单验证模块,用于在客户端对用户输入进行校验。通过它,开发者可以很容易地在网页的表单中添加验证功能,从而提升用户体验。以下是jQuery Validate插件表单验证的基本用法...
4. 数值范围验证:如年龄不能小于0,价格不能为负数。 5. 数据唯一性验证:如用户名、邮箱等需保证全局唯一。 6. 正则表达式验证:用于复杂格式的输入,如网址、身份证号等。 三、“formValidate.jsp”文件可能包含...
5. **digits**:只允许输入数字,不允许小数或负数。 6. **url**:验证输入是否符合URL格式。 7. **date**:验证输入是否为有效日期。 8. **equalTo**:验证输入是否与另一个字段的值相等,常用于确认密码。 ### ...
在开发Web应用时,表单验证是不可或缺的一部分,它确保用户输入的数据符合预期的格式和规则,从而提高数据质量和安全性。Java作为后端语言,通常处理由前端提交的已验证数据,而前端验证则主要通过JavaScript来实现...
在实际应用中,开发者可能需要根据业务需求调整插件的配置,例如设定允许的最大值、最小值,是否允许负数,以及具体的数字格式。通过阅读`使用说明.txt`和`参数含义.txt`,可以了解如何设置这些选项以满足具体需求。...
7. `number`: 验证输入是否为合法的数字(包括负数和小数)。 8. `digits`: 只允许输入整数。 9. `creditcard`: 验证输入是否为合法的信用卡号。 10. `equalTo`: 输入值必须与指定字段(如`#field`)的值相同。 11. ...
JQuery Validate插件,作为JQuery的一个扩展,为开发者提供了一套强大的工具集,用于实现表单验证功能。通过预定义的规则和自定义错误消息,它能够帮助开发者轻松地创建用户友好的交互体验,同时提高应用程序的健壮...
标题"输入textbox控件只能输入数字"所描述的问题就是如何在TextBox控件中实现这个功能,确保用户只能输入数字,防止输入其他字符,这在诸如数据录入、年龄验证等场景中尤为常见。 要实现这一目标,开发者可以采用...
jQuery 验证控件 jquery.validate.js 是一个功能强大且广泛使用的 JavaScript 验证插件,旨在帮助开发者快速实现表单验证功能。下面是 jquery.validate.js 的使用说明和中文 API。 导入 jQuery 库和 jquery....
jQuery Validate插件是用于jQuery的一个强大验证工具,它简化了表单验证的过程,允许开发者定义自定义的验证规则和错误消息。本文将深入讲解如何使用jQuery Validate结合正则表达式实现高效且灵活的表单验证。 首先...
jQuery Validate是一个强大的表单验证插件,它允许开发者快速对表单元素进行验证,并提供友好的用户交互反馈。本篇内容将深入探讨如何使用jQuery Validate表单验证,并演示如何将校验规则直接写在HTML元素的class...
`jQuery-validation`是一个广泛使用的JavaScript库,用于在前端进行表单验证。这个插件使得开发者可以轻松地添加各种验证规则,提高用户体验,并确保用户在提交数据之前满足特定的输入要求。以下是对`jQuery-...
jQuery.validate.js是一个非常流行的JavaScript库,它为jQuery提供了一个强大的表单验证功能。这个插件使得在网页上创建用户输入验证变得简单而直观,能够帮助开发者确保用户提交的数据符合预设的规则,从而提高用户...